About ThriveMD ThriveMD is a concierge longevity and regenerative medicine practice redefining personalized healthcare. We bypass insurance constraints to deliver high-touch, individualized programming — spanning hormone optimization, Stem Cell Therapy, PRP, Therapeutic Plasma Exchange, and Peptide Therapy — with a focus on advanced diagnostics and proactive healthspan optimization. We're actively growing our Centennial location and exploring additional Denver metro expansion, making this an exciting time to join the team. About the Role This is not a traditional front desk job. As our Patient Coordinator, you are often the first voice a patient hears and a consistent touchpoint throughout their care journey. Our patients are invested, health-forward individuals who expect a concierge experience — and you'll play a meaningful role in delivering that. Our practice operates primarily via telehealth with some in-person visits, so comfort with both environments is important. We are also in an exciting period of systems evolution — our team currently works across multiple platforms with some manual workflows alongside our EHR, and we're actively building toward a more streamlined tech stack. This means we need someone who is flexible, resourceful, and can adapt quickly to how different providers like to work. Patient volume is intentional and unhurried — we spend more time with each patient, which means some days will have natural downtime. We're looking for someone who is proactive, finds productive ways to fill that time, and takes initiative on things like patient follow-up outreach, scheduling optimization, and keeping things organized behind the scenes. What You'll Do Coordinate patient scheduling across telehealth and in-person appointments, including procedure and treatment-based sequencing Manage patient communications — calls, follow-ups, pre/post-appointment outreach Maintain accurate records across multiple systems, including manual entry and EHR documentation Support medication coordination and lab scheduling workflows Collaborate fluidly with a dynamic team and adapt to varying provider preferences and workflows Contribute to a consistently warm, professional, and concierge-level patient experience Who May Be a Strong Fit Candidates with front office or coordinator experience from backgrounds such as: Medical receptionist, patient coordinator, or healthcare admin Women's health, hormone therapy, functional medicine, or longevity-focused practice Regenerative medicine, stem cell therapy, or procedure-based scheduling Clinical medical assistant transitioning to a coordinator-focused role Experience in regenerative or longevity medicine is not required — we'll train the right person.
